Find the nth term of 8, 2, -4, -10,... then find A50

Mathematics
1 answer:
kumpel [21]3 years ago
7 0

Answer:

An=8+(n-1)(-6)

=8-6n+6

=14-6n

A50=14-6(50)

= -286
